About

Subhasmita Swain is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Subhasmita Swain has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 268 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 7 papers in Materials Chemistry and 6 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Subhasmita Swain’s work include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(23 papers),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(7 papers) and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(5 papers). Subhasmita Swain is often cited by papers focused on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(23 papers),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(7 papers) and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(5 papers). Subhasmita Swain collaborates with scholars based in India, United States and South Korea. Subhasmita Swain's co-authors include Tapash R. Rautray, Rabindra N. Padhy, R. Narayanan, Chris Bowen, Janardhan Reddy Koduru, R.D.K. Misra, Kyo‐Han Kim, Sapna Mishra and Joo L. Ong and has published in prestigious journals such as Molecules, Materials and International Journal of Nanomedicine.
